LATEST TRENDS
Integration of voice biometrics into IVR systems leading market expansion
A recent trend observed in the market is the integration of voice biometrics into IVR systems. Voice biometrics is one on growing trends in interactive voice response development and innovation. The method of identifying and authenticating a caller based on these unique voice characteristics is called voice biometrics. Voice biometrics can increase security, convenience and personalization for callers and call centers. It also allows contact centers to tailor their services and offers to the caller's profile and interests.

For example, RTD's updated Next Ride IVR, an interactive voice response system, makes it easy to schedule a bus arrival time at a desired stop. Accessible by phone or online, the real-time system records delays on both bus and train systems and includes stop cancellations or disruptions. The Next Ride IVR now has more accurate speech recognition, allowing callers to interact with the system without using a voice keyboard.
